Galen Rowell, who has died aged 61, with his wife Barbara in a plane crash in California, was the most famous outdoor photographer in the world, regularly shooting features for National Geographic during a life spent travelling in remote countries around the world.

Wilderness shapes the American consciousness in ways few Britons appreciate, and Rowell was at the heart of that tradition. It also gave him a market to exploit. His father, a college professor, and mother, a concert cellist, took him camping in the Sierras before Rowell could walk, and his early engagement with wild places seems to have shaped his psychology for the rest of his life.

By the age of 10 he was climbing mountains on Sierra Club outings, the conservation organisation founded in 1892 by John Muir and shaped by Ansel Adams. He remained a staunch supporter for the rest of his life.

By 16 he had started doing roped climbs on the vast granite cliffs of Yosemite, adding over a hundred new climbs there and in the Sierras during the 1960s and 70s. It was his experiences there that gave him his break as a photographer. Rowell dropped out of college at Berkeley and worked instead as a mechanic to fund his climbing.

While taking photographs to show his family and non-climbing friends what he was up to on the big walls of Yosemite, he became increasingly intrigued by the process of forming an image, and inspired by Adams's vision of Yosemite. While Adams maintained distance and control of his images, Rowell, as a climber, knew the cliffs intimately, and his early pictures have an intensity which contrasted with his illustrious predecessor.

Within a year of turning professional, in 1972, he was shooting pictures of Yosemite pioneer Warren Harding for National Geographic. The assignment, at a time when there were fewer skilled climbing photographers, led to a rush of work all over the world for many of the top American magazines.

Rowell eventually visited all seven continents, producing a substantial portfolio reproduced in articles and books of both polar regions, the Himalayas - in particular Tibet - and South America.

In the early 1980s, after publishing books about his years in Yosemite and the impact of tourism in Nepal and other Himalayan countries, Rowell was asked by Robert Redford to guide him on a trip to Nepal. Their friendship led to an exhibition of Rowell's work on 5th Avenue in New York, a project which was published in his greatest book, Mountain Light, which captured the essence of his philosophy.

Rowell turned his back on the large-format cameras of his landscape contemporaries, preferring the immediacy of the 35mm camera. He liked to have the latest equipment and was quick to take advantage of graduated filters, but he would toss his camera in a rucksack, wrapped in his bedding roll, rather than get too hung up on the technology.

For him, experiencing landscapes as close up as possible was at the centre of his work. He spent long periods in the field looking for the right combination of light and form. This devotion reached its apotheosis just outside Lhasa in 1981, when a rainbow touched the roof of the Dalai Lama's Potala Palace, Rowell's most famous image. Rowell had to race across the valley to align the shot correctly, quite literally chasing a rainbow.

These moments of sublimity, almost always shot in perfect light, drifted into sentimentalism at times, especially in his later work. Rowell was a populist, on a mission to share his technical insight with amateur photographers and determined to share an idealised vision of the American landscape in particular. While British photographers like Fay Godwin present a more equivocal view and work in less than perfect light, Rowell wanted simply to inspire and it made his work commercially successful.

This process was accelerated after he married his second wife, Barbara, at the time a communications director. She took over the commercial side of Rowell's ever-expanding archive, giving him his pre-eminent position in outdoor photography. Later, she developed her own photographic career alongside his, while learning to fly and to speak Spanish, both useful skills in the preparation of her first book, an account of a journey through Latin America due for publication at the time of her death.

Rowell is survived by two children from his first marriage.

· Galen Rowell, photographer, born August 23 1940, died August 11 2002

Provide an example of a famous painting that incorporated deconstruction.

Answers

Olympia, by Edouard Manet.
This painting was controversial because it created something that at first glance looked like a regular classic n-ude painting, but after looking at the painting for a deeper meaning you will find that it shows the poor conditions of women in France during this period and criticized how women were treated in French society by men.

whats skeletal energy

Answers

Explanation:

To meet the increased energy needs of exercise, skeletal muscle has a variety of metabolic pathways that produce ATP both anaerobically (requiring no oxygen) and aerobically. These pathways are activated simultaneously from the onset of exercise to precisely meet the demands of a given exercise situation.
